If an event or
performer is cancelled, do I get a refund on my tickets?
If the show is cancelled, you will be issued a refund, excluding
delivery and service fees. Tickets must be brought back to the
Moncton Coliseum Box Office, or returned by mail (see "Contact
Us" for address). If the "supporting artists"
of an event are substituted there are no refunds, exchanges,
or cancellations.
If I don't want
my tickets or am not able to attend the event, can I get a refund?
No, There are no exchanges, refunds or cancellations
permitted, deemed as Policy by the show Promoters and Moncton
Coliseum Complex.
If there's bad
weather reported for the event, am I able to get a refund if
I can't make the show?
Refunds are not given for bad weather unless the event cancels.
Always check the
local weather conditions prior to departing for the event
to ensure a safe driving experience. If the event is cancelled
or postponed due to the weather, you will either receive a refund,
excluding Delivery Fees and Service Fees (for cancelled events),
or requested to stay tuned for the postponed date, at which
time you will be advised what to do with your tickets. If the
event cancels, do not dispose of your tickets, simply return
them to the Coliseum Box Office in person, or return by mail
to receive your refund. (See"Contact
Us" for address)

Can I bring my
camera or video recorder to an event?
The use of cameras and recording equipment is usually prohibited
by the Promoter for concerts and exhibitions. Some performances
do permit it. Check the Event Schedule
for the information on the event.
Can I bring food,
beverages or snacks to an event?
The Moncton Coliseum has full canteen service and vending machines
available throughout the venue, for most events and a Restaurant
that is open for some Trade Shows and Exhibitions. Outside
beverages or food are not permitted.
Do
you search people coming into an event?
For most events, we have hired security or Police for your protection.
For selected events, there may be a Search and Seizure in progress.
Fans attempting to enter the venue with alcohol or drugs may
be denied entry and have their ticket confiscated, without compensation.
Management reserves the right
to refuse access to the event or evict any person where behavior
is deemed inappropriate.
If
I get hurt at the event, is there First-Aid available?
Yes, we have St. John Ambulance on hand for most events at the
Coliseum. They are located under Section 12 in the Lower Bowl.
Should you get injured while attending an event at the Coliseum,
see the Ushers or Security located within the building. If the
injury is of a serious nature, please inform the Management
of the Coliseum in person or by calling 506-857-4100. The
holder of the ticket assumes any and all liabilities as to the
risks and danger that may result from the event and waives any
claim for loss or damage whatever the cause, incurred or suffered,
whether occurring before, during or after the event.

Is
there sufficient parking at the Moncton Coliseum?
Yes, the Moncton Coliseum has parking spaces for approximately
1800 vehicles. Disability parking is located nearest the main
entrance of the building and are marked accordingly. Come early
to get the best parking.
Can
I smoke in the Moncton Coliseum or Exhibition areas?
No, smoking is strictly prohibited. For most events, you may
be permitted to leave the venue to have a cigarette and return
to the event.
If
I'm under 12 years of age, am I able to attend an event without
my parents or an adult?
All children 12 years of age and under must be accompanied by
an adult.

Seating
and Services for the Disabled:
Do
I need a special ticket location if I'm disabled?
The Moncton Coliseum is wheelchair
accessible. The Moncton Coliseum has 3 seating locations available
for disabled patrons with a wheelchair. They are located behind
section 4, 8 and 16 of the Coliseum. There are 8 locations available
in each section along with 8 locations for attendees. If you
are in a wheelchair, please arrange to arrive at the venue for
the event, 45 minutes to an hour prior to the start time to
ensure easier access. Disabled patrons and Attendees pay the
regular price of admission. Promoters may grant a discount to
disabled patrons for selected events. When purchasing tickets,
please state that you'd like a ticket in the Wheelchair section.
If you have an Attendant with you, please state that you'd like
an Attendee's ticket in the same section.

Moncton
Wildcats Game Questions:
What is a Flex
Pack?
A Flex ticket is a ticket without a specific seat assigned to
it. If you have a Flex Ticket, you must redeem it at the Coliseum
Box Office for a ticket and seat to the game. Having a Flex
ticket does not guarantee you a seat for the game. Tickets will
be distributed on a first-come - first-serve basis. Flex tickets
may only be redeemed at the Moncton Coliseum Box Office and
not by phones or Online sales. If you have a large number of
Flex tickets to redeem, please do so during normal Box Office
Hours Monday through Friday 10am to 6pm and Saturday 10am to
2pm.
